#197150 basic color information

#197150

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#197150 has decimal index of: 1667408, is composed of 9.8% red, 44.3% green and 31.4% blue. #197150 in CMYK color model, is composed of 77.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.2% yellow and 55.7% black.
#006666 is the closest web-safe color to #197150.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
